Output 08aa58391c5ee38fbc9d9db3231995dc9126e5dd0056ea51ad02fb3e36d09358:0

value
40776523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16283b1e046c28578c65335f3728cf00b6b023f OP_EQUAL
address
3NEjycEuCukKHNPTY52r9vfY3GQhpdfhoQ
transaction
08aa58391c5ee38fbc9d9db3231995dc9126e5dd0056ea51ad02fb3e36d09358
spent
true